The study
| Bonnaire, C., & Lambert, L. (2026). From healthy to problematic gaming use: Considering the role of age. Journal of Behavioral Addictions. |
This commentary makes two arguments about the line between healthy and disordered gaming. First, time spent playing is a poor diagnostic signal: hours alone fail to separate the passionate gamer, the professional, and the person in real trouble, and treating duration as the marker leads to both over- and under-recognition. Second, age matters — gaming begins in childhood, is legal across the lifespan, can benefit development, and accompanies people through stages when the brain’s control systems are still maturing. The authors argue that diagnostic criteria should bend to developmental stage rather than apply uniformly.
My take
They are right, and the first point is one I keep arriving at from the other direction — the clinic. The count is the seduction; the function is the finding. What a person plays away from, and what the playing costs them, tells me far more than the number of hours ever will. But I would offer three refinements from practice, because the paper, in its proper caution against overpathologizing, lets go of more than I would.
First, time is the wrong metric — until it isn’t. At the extreme, quantity becomes its own quality. An adolescent, or an adult, who plays fifteen or more hours a day, day after day, is not a case where hours are merely uninformative; at that magnitude nothing else in a life survives, and the number has become the finding. The field has corrected so hard against time that it risks waving away the outlier it should not.
Second, the signal is rarely time itself — it is time measured against what the time costs. Four hours on a school night and eight on a summer afternoon are not the same behavior scaled up and down. The summer eight may displace little; the school-night four can cost sleep, study, and the next morning. The same hours read as benign or alarming depending entirely on what they take the place of. That is the reading the raw count obscures.
Third, developmental stage matters more than the paper’s own instrument can capture — because chronological age is a poor proxy for developmental maturity. The argument to adapt criteria by stage is correct in spirit, but the variable that matters is the maturity of the regulatory system, and that is not reliably indexed by the birthday. It is not uncommon to see a sixteen-year-old more developmentally advanced than a twenty-two-year-old. “Impaired control” has to be judged against the control the person actually has, not the control their age is presumed to confer.

None of this contradicts the paper; it sharpens it. The clock is the wrong instrument for the ordinary case, a necessary one at the extreme, and useful in between only when read against context and against the person’s real, rather than assumed, developmental stage. As ever, the behavior is not the finding. What it costs, and who is doing it, is.
